Stats Reference

HR - Homeruns
PA - Plate Appearances
The number of times a batter makes an appearance at the plate and completes an at bat.
AB - At Bat
When a batter reaches base via a fielder's choice, hit, or an error (not including catcher's interference), or when a batter gets out on a non-sacrifice.
SLG - Slugging Percentage
The average number of bases a batter reaches per at bat.
Formula
SLG = TB/AB
BA - Batting Average
The average times a batter reaches base by getting a hit.
QAB - Quality At Bat
A quality at bat is when the batter gets a hit, walks, gets a sacrifice, or sees 7+ pitches in a single at bat.
QBA - Quality Batting Average
The average times a batter has a quality at bat per plate appearance.
Formula
QBA = QAB / PA
H - Hits
XBH - Extra Base Hits
The number of times a batter gets a double, triple, or homerun.
Formula
XBH = 2B + 3B + HR
R - Runs
The number of times the batter crosses the plate.
RBI - Runs Batted In
OBP - On Base Percentage
The average number of times the runner gets on base compared to their number of at bats, walks, times hit by a pitch, and sacrifices.
Formula
OBP = (H + BB + HBP)/(AB + BB + HBP + SACS)
OPS - On Base Plus Slugging
The average number of times a player gets on base plus their average of how many bases they typical get per at bat. It is a measurement to tell how well a batter can get on base and hit for power.
Formula
OPS = OBP + SLG
